You are not certified until legal approves your account so make sure you get your waiver signed by Fed Ex and returned to you before you ship.
 
Yea, I know. I got my waiver a week ago. Took about a week after they approved me which was a week or two after sending my test shipment.
 
You don't need to have a business name. You would still put in your home address, but not ship to/from it.
